Commission adopts change to first compliance date for reporting to poison centres

The European Commission has adopted a delegated act amending the CLP Regulation, which will postpone the first compliance date for harmonised reporting to poison centres, for mixtures intended for consumer use, from 1 January 2020 to 1 January 2021. Other compliance dates will not be affected.

Helsinki, 12 January 2017 - ECHA has added four new SVHCs to the Candidate List

Helsinki, 12 January 2017 - ECHA has added four new SVHCs to the Candidate List based on proposals by France, Sweden, Germany and Austria, following the SVHC identification process with involvement of the Member State Committee.

The SVHCs Canditate List now contains 173 substances.

Biocidal Products Regulation, companies can submit a declaration of interest to notify to ECHA until 3 October 2016

The European Commission and Member States have repealed the Manual of Decisions concerning the old Biocidal Products Directive. Companies who, on the basis of the manual, considered their product to be excluded from the scope of the biocides legislation can contact their national helpdesk to check whether the status has changed. If the product could now fall under the new Biocidal Products Regulation, companies can submit a declaration of interest to notify to ECHA until 3 October 2016.

As of 09/01/2013 the new EU Biocides Directive applies

In the official register of the European Union (L 167 on 06/27/2012) the new regulation (EU) No. 528/2012 of the European parliament and council from May, the 22nd 2012 about the placement on the market and the usage of biocidal products was published .
